Actually, the only small qualm I have is that Knights of the Old Republic (KOTOR) is NOT a MMORPG. It's an RPG by Bioware (and the sequel was developed by Obsidian). Both KOTOR and KOTOR 2 were released on PC, Mac, and Xbox (compatible Xbox 360). Just be aware that the PC version of KOTOR doesn't accept controllers. If you played and liked Mass Effect, you have (kinda) an idea of how the game is -- it's typical Bioware fare. :)

And it's not the same thing as Star Wars: The Old Republic (TOR), which was also developed by Bioware and IS actually a MMORPG.

Well, it does matter that KOTOR is an RPG but not a MMORPG because it's a 1-player game and it's offline. So it's still playable today on PC or Xbox/Xbox 360, whereas Star Wars: The Old Republic may very well not be accessible 5 or 10 years from now.
